TICKET: Sort order flip-flopping in Tallyhawk report builder

Heads up, plugin folks — some of you noticed exports sorting differently between runs. Turns out two app nodes drifted from the provisioned config and fell back to an unstable sort. We're re-syncing tonight; until then, don't rely on row order in your export hooks. For transparency, the drifted node's active settings are listed here.

deployment values, fahap-hahaf:
[casdor]
port = 9200
region = south-2
host = casdor.qirvanworks.corp
timeout_ms = 3000
retries = 4

Dear reception colleagues, please note that the mail room is moving from the ground floor to room 114 on the first floor of Elmsdale House this Friday. All incoming post should be redirected there from Monday onward. The old room will be locked permanently once the move completes. Room 114 has a keypad lock, and you will need the entry code given below.

door code, fawef-faduf: bdg-JVUCQ-8

The fleet fuel-usage report is served by the Tankmeter internal API. Contractors: request the report via POST with a vehicle-group identifier and a date range; responses are paginated at 500 rows and include liters consumed, idle burn, and route distance. Rates are computed nightly, so same-day figures are provisional. All requests must include an authorization header or they are rejected before routing. For sandbox work, authenticate against the Tankmeter staging environment using the key provided immediately below.

gateway credential: kto3_qfe